TRACKING___The nationwide curfew which was announced by the president a week ago begins today. The curfew which is part of the measures by government to forestall the spread of the coronavirus is between the hours of 8pm to 6am.
Recall that President of Nigeria, Muhammadu Buhari during his last media broadcast on Monday 30th May ordered a nationwide curfew from 8pm to 6am beginning from today to curb COVID – 19 spread across the country.
He also ordered a two- week total lockdown in Kano State with immediate effect which is already in its second week.
This is coming as the president approved a “ phased and gradual easing ” of the lockdown in the FCT, Lagos and Ogun states beginning from May 4.
The three states as well as several other states across the country have been on lockdown for more than 4 weeks now.
The President also mandated the compulsory use of face masks or coverings by citizens in public in addition to maintaining physical distancing and personal hygiene.
However, question marks have been raised concerning the planned easing of the lockdown beginning from May 4 as the coronavirus cases in Nigeria continues to rise rapidly on a daily basis.
So far Nigeria has recorded 2558 confirmed cases of the virus with 87 deaths.
